What is Gotcha Day?

Gotcha Day isn't a widely known holiday, but for pet owners who adopted their animals, it’s a significant personal event. It marks the day the adoption was finalized, the day a new chapter began, filled with unconditional love, companionship, and unforgettable memories. It's a celebration of the rescue, the connection, and the journey shared. This day provides a beautiful opportunity to reflect on the transformative power of pet adoption and the unique bond between humans and animals.

What are Some Creative Ways to Commemorate Gotcha Day?

Beyond heartfelt quotes, there are countless ways to make Gotcha Day extra special:

  • Photo album or scrapbook: Gather photos from the day you adopted your pet and throughout your life together, creating a treasured keepsake.
  • Social media post: Share your favorite photos and videos, along with a touching quote, and use hashtags like #GotchaDay, #PetAdoption, and #RescueDog (or cat, etc.).
  • Special treats and toys: Spoil your pet with their favorite treats and toys.
  • Donation to a shelter: In honor of your pet's Gotcha Day, consider donating to the shelter or rescue organization where you adopted them. This act of kindness extends the circle of love and support.
  • Small party or outing: Celebrate with a small gathering of friends and family, or take your pet on a special outing to their favorite park or beach.

How do I find out my pet's Gotcha Day?

If you adopted your pet through a shelter or rescue organization, their records should contain the official adoption date. Contact the organization if you are unable to locate this information. For pets acquired through other means, the date you brought them home could be considered your Gotcha Day.
